  • Accurate, yes.. Realistic, not so much. From what I can tell, the medical terms and definitions are used appropriately (for the most part) and conditions are as described, if exaggerated somewhat for dramatic effect. The illnesses have all been fairly real and plausible. The procedures are basically as presented, except much faster than in real life. However, as far as representing a real hospital.. as someone who works in one I have to laugh at the total lack of nurses, lab techs, physicians assistants, etc in this hospital. There is NO WAY that even the most talented doctors would be qualified to perform *every* procedure in the hospital.. not even between 4 of them. This would never happen. But again, it's more dramatic to watch them doing the tests themselves rather than ordering them on the computer and waiting for results, and then they get to be there when Something Goes Horribly Wrong during the procedure. LOL Even though I have to giggle at some of the liberties I do love this show.. and what is kind of accurate in a way is how the more prestigious doctors actually rarely have to see patients and have a team of underlings doing all the hands-on stuff for them. Plus they do hit on some of the more annoying aspects of clinic-based care (patients who diagnose themselves on the internet, patients who lie about their conditions, etc).
